In a breakthrough, Verna police have arrested three accused in connection with a highway robbery near Loto Garage in Santrant, Cortalim on January 8.
The accused have been identified as Sachit Naik (55) a businessman from Sancoale, Gokuldas Naik (45) of Borim, and Mandar Prabhu (31) of Shiroda.
The complainant, Vijayan T Thottarayath, a 52-year-old businessman and proprietor of a bar and restaurant, was brutally attacked and robbed while driving towards Margao in his car (GA-06-F-3354).
According to the complaint, two masked men in a white car intercepted his vehicle, blocked his path, and assaulted him with iron pipes, causing serious injuries at around 5.10 am.
The robbers forcibly snatched a gold chain, a mobile handset, and Rs 10,000 in cash from Thottarayath, amounting to a total loss of Rs 2,00,000. The victim suffered injuries to his right leg, wrist, and head.
Acting promptly on the complaint, Verna Police registered a case and launched an investigation. Based on intelligence inputs, Sachit Naik (55), a businessman from Sancoale, was arrested on January 9, while Gokuldas Naik (45) and Mandar Prabhu (31), were arrested on January 10.
The accused have been remanded to police custody. Sachit Naik was initially remanded to three days in custody on January 10, while Gokuldas and Mandar were remanded to two days on January 11. All three were further remanded to three more days of custody on January 13, as the investigation continues.
One of the accused, Mandar Prabhu, has a history of criminal involvement, with cases registered against him at Ponda and Quepem police stations.
